>>>>>> + hw_rev = (enum ath12k_hw_rev)of_device_get_match_data(&pdev->dev);
>>>>>
>>>>> kernel test robot warns:
>>>>> cast to smaller integer type 'enum ath12k_hw_rev' from 'const void *'
>>>>>
>>>>> looks like others have fixed this by first casting to (uintptr_t)
>>>>> a few examples:
>>>>>
>>>> Cast via (kernel_ulong_t)
>>>>
>>>> But another point is that this patch at stage v11 should not have
>>>> compiler warnings and it's not our tools who should point it out. Except
>>>> W=1, all standard static analyzers (sparse, smatch and coccinelle) are
>>>> expected to be run.
>>>
>>> I ran what I thought was a reasonable cross-section of builds and did not see
>>> this issue. Seems this issue is only flagged with config: um-allmodconfig ??
>>>
>>> Guess I need to add that configuration to my builds...
>>
>> This should be visible on every build on 32 bit archs.
Yes, I'm seeing it now on my i386 builds
